Output 58ea9320a2018bf1055dd5c76ecee8e0cb1edf6a01b3ff7ead8d565b3e8b65c8:1

value
9354813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fc35352dce4e1c91f3e19c210c77906632bd750 OP_EQUAL
address
3EoAYRn2kxvmSuAXoYCisgBzMnBgwVXhQb
transaction
58ea9320a2018bf1055dd5c76ecee8e0cb1edf6a01b3ff7ead8d565b3e8b65c8
spent
true